Longer Steroid Treatment Increases Secondary Bloodstream Infection Risk Among Patients With COVID-19 Requiring Intensive Care
Conclusions
We found a positive association between the duration of corticosteroids and the development of BSI. Considering immunosuppression is now the cornerstone of guidelines for COVID-19 treatment, further studies are needed to evaluate risks and mitigation strategies for these therapies.
